Threat Actors Agrius

Also known as: Pink Sandstorm, AMERICIUM, Agonizing Serpens, BlackShadow, DEV-0022, Agrius, UNC2428, Black Shadow, SPECTRAL KITTEN

Description

Agrius is an Iranian threat actor active since 2020 notable for a series of ransomware and wiper operations in the Middle East, with an emphasis on Israeli targets.(Citation: SentinelOne Agrius 2021)(Citation: CheckPoint Agrius 2023) Public reporting has linked Agrius to Iran's Ministry of Intelligence and Security (MOIS).(Citation: Microsoft Iran Cyber 2023)

Executive Summary

Agrius is an Iranian state‑linked threat actor active since 2020, known for deploying ransomware and destructive wiper payloads against Middle‑East organizations, with a pronounced focus on Israeli entities. Public reporting ties the group to Iran's Ministry of Intelligence and Security (MOIS), suggesting a strategic motive aligned with Iranian geopolitical objectives. Their operations combine credential theft, lateral movement, and data destruction to achieve both financial gain and disruptive impact.

Goals & Targeting

Agrius appears driven by a blend of strategic and financial objectives. Strategically, the group targets Israeli and broader Middle‑East sectors that are critical to national security and economic stability—such as government, energy, telecom, and finance—to exert pressure, gather intelligence, and demonstrate capability on behalf of Iranian state interests. Financially, the ransomware campaigns provide a revenue stream that can fund further operations or be used as a lever in geopolitical negotiations. Typical victims are organizations with high‑value data, limited segmentation, and reliance on legacy systems, making them attractive for both data exfiltration and destructive impact.

Enhanced Description

Agrius, also referenced under aliases such as Pink Sandstorm, BlackShadow, UNC2428, and SPECTRAL KITTEN, emerged in 2020 and quickly gained notoriety for a series of ransomware and wiper campaigns targeting critical infrastructure and private sector organizations across the Middle East. The group’s tooling includes a custom ransomware family often delivered alongside a destructive wiper component that overwrites or corrupts system files, rendering affected machines inoperable. Victimology shows a clear emphasis on Israeli government agencies, energy providers, telecommunications firms, and financial institutions, aligning with broader Iranian state interests. Technical analyses indicate that Agrius leverages a multi‑stage intrusion chain. Initial access is frequently achieved through spear‑phishing emails containing macro‑laden Office documents or malicious links, occasionally supplemented by exploitation of unpatched VPN or web‑application vulnerabilities. Once inside, the actors employ credential‑dumping tools such as Mimikatz, use PowerShell for file‑less execution, and move laterally via PsExec, Windows Management Instrumentation (WMI), and legitimate remote administration tools. The payloads are staged on compromised hosts before being delivered via encrypted HTTP/S or DNS tunneling to a bullet‑proof C2 infrastructure. The ransomware component encrypts data using strong asymmetric keys and drops a ransom note that references the group’s name, while the wiper module executes low‑level disk‑write operations that permanently erase critical system files. Post‑encryption, the actors often delete logs, remove shadow copies, and employ obfuscation techniques to hinder forensic analysis. Their operational tempo spikes around regional geopolitical events, suggesting a dual motive of financial extortion and strategic disruption. Attribution assessments from multiple vendors—including SentinelOne, Check Point, and Microsoft—consistently link Agrius to Iran's MOIS, citing overlapping code, infrastructure, and TTPs with other known Iranian groups. While the exact command hierarchy remains opaque, the evidence points to a well‑funded, state‑sponsored entity capable of both cyber‑espionage and destructive sabotage.

Campaigns & Victims

Since its first observed activity in 2020, Agrius has conducted at least three major campaign waves, each coinciding with heightened regional tensions. The 2021 wave focused on Israeli municipal and healthcare systems, employing spear‑phishing with macro‑laden documents. In 2022, the group shifted to a hybrid ransomware‑wiper approach against energy and telecom operators, leveraging compromised VPN credentials for initial footholds. The most recent 2023 operations intensified during the Israel‑Hamas conflict, targeting government ministries and financial institutions with rapid‑deployment wiper payloads designed to cause maximal operational disruption. Across campaigns, the group consistently uses bullet‑proof hosting in Eastern Europe, fast‑flux DNS, and encrypted C2 channels to obscure attribution and maintain persistence.

Confidence Assessment

Confidence in the attribution of Agrius to Iranian MOIS and its primary TTPs is moderate to high, supported by multiple independent vendor reports and overlapping code artifacts. However, gaps remain regarding the group's exact funding mechanisms, internal hierarchy, and the full extent of its toolset, as some capabilities are inferred from observed behavior rather than direct sample analysis. Continuous monitoring and collection of fresh indicators are needed to refine the actor profile.
